Cozy historic Natchez cottage close to downtown and the river

Constructed in the early 1900s, Jacqueline's Cottage is located behind Myrtle Bank, a larger home built in 1835, which is also available for nightly and weekly rental. The cottage is tucked away in the back of the property, giving it plenty of privacy and relaxation. Together with Myrtle Bank, it makes a perfect compound for wedding parties and large family gatherings. Alone, it is a perfect retreat for long Natchez weekends, offering close proximity to downtown and the mighty Mississippi.
